About Dawei Yun
Dawei Yun is a scholar working on Biochemistry, Biomaterials, Food Science, Applied Microbiology and Biotechnology and Plant Science, having authored 40 papers that have together received 1.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Nanocomposite Films for Food Packaging (28 papers), Postharvest Quality and Shelf Life Management (16 papers), Phytochemicals and Antioxidant Activities (16 papers), Botanical Research and Applications (8 papers), Tea Polyphenols and Effects (4 papers), Polysaccharides Composition and Applications (4 papers), Lignin and Wood Chemistry (2 papers) and Dyeing and Modifying Textile Fibers (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Biomaterials (993 citations), Biochemistry (261 citations), Food Science (474 citations), Animal Science and Zoology (148 citations) and Plant Science (334 citations). Dawei Yun has collaborated with scholars based in China, United Kingdom and Yemen. Frequent co-authors include Jun Liu, Fengfeng Xu, Huimin Yong, Huixia Hu, Xiyu Yao, Dan Chen, Juan Kan, Yan Qin, Lixia Xiao and Chenchen Li. Their work appears in journals such as International Journal of Biological Macromolecules, Food Hydrocolloids, Foods, Food Bioscience and Journal of the Science of Food and Agriculture.
